Output d16576ba987324cf93b7fdeb2d973dd040998e5c85171cc1641545b651eacb5d:0
- value
- 2653640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c407bed180150975d89d26dc83239fbd57e15ee OP_EQUAL
- address
- 38eCXZBmyFGZ2TjPiepKnsCw88knnJ7zi9
- transaction
- d16576ba987324cf93b7fdeb2d973dd040998e5c85171cc1641545b651eacb5d
- confirmations
- 310568
- spent
- true